#036337 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#036337 is composed of 1.2% red, 38.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 152.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 20%. #036337 color hex could be obtained by blending #06c66e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#036337 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#036337 has RGB values of R:3, G:99,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 222007.

Shades and Tints of #036337

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000402 is the darkest color, while #f0f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#036337

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#323433 is the less saturated color, while #036337 is the most saturated one.
